Hands-On: Norco SS-500 Backplane Hot Swap Module
Backplane Hot Swap Modules are one the more popular “optional” items that are found in Windows Home Server machines. Popularized by HP MSS machines, these modules have found their into many competitor’s WHS-specific machines and many home-built machines. They really are a very useful addition to WHS computers, especially as one begins to swap drives to provide an increased level of backup protection.
Today, I am taking a look at the Norco SS-500 Backplane Hot Swap Module. This is 5 bay module that fits in (3) 5-1/4” case bays.
